Output c5640a0fe613acd75d61e6da3d474169f159a9f3a0d3a4e59f55e020089b6421:1

value
2434069421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0c0656c37bb1da723b304b5606722b2a29baa1 OP_EQUAL
address
3PD7oJynz5Ys6GYcEUh1FJRJvy5R5h7weE
transaction
c5640a0fe613acd75d61e6da3d474169f159a9f3a0d3a4e59f55e020089b6421
confirmations
266120
spent
true